The only sounds disturbing the nighttime tranquility are the soft hoot of an owl or the steady tread of deer
meandering through the tree-sheltered back yard. Nights are so dark here that countless stars are visible; you
can clearly see the Milky Way.
There is nothing as refreshing and rejuvenating as an escape into the quietness of nature. Our area has an
abundance of wildlife, including whitetail deer, Canadian geese, Mallard ducks, wild turkey, ring neck pheasant,
bobwhite quail, and beaver. Now is a good time to spot Bald Eagles soaring close to the water. If you enjoy
wandering through the wildlife and parks lands we would be glad to direct you to some prime areas. Winter is a
good time to hike.

The Marion Reservoir has plenty of room for water sports and jet skiers. There are plenty of places to go bird watching ,
bicycling and hiking around the Reservoir too.
